My favorite overall was Seven, though I do wish they'd let the character arc go as a Borg that was acculturating to humanity rather than her just becoming human again.

In the first year Chakotay was my favorite, maverick Marquis opposite straitlaced federation captain had fireworks and an energy that Trek hasn't had for me since TOS. Sadly, the character languished as the series went on.

I liked the Doctor purely for Picardo's acting. He was a pleasure to watch, but as a part of the ship, I can't imagine why Janeway didn't reboot him till she got the Doc she wanted. Overall though, he was great fun.

I liked Neelix, he was an everyman of sorts. Used too often as only comic relief he faded into an annoying one note joke too often, but when he shone he was great. At his best, he strove to do the best, despite what he might have been afraid he felt himself to be. His best stories were what I watch Trek for.

Lastly Janeway, she was written all over the map. Hidebound starfleet officer, maverick, scientist, obsessive, and all around complex character. I feel that it was only Mulgrew's acting that kept the character believable. The many faces of Janeway could have been far too discordent in another actor's hands.
